Bhagirathi I

Despite sickness and very poor weather conditions, Martin Moran, John Mothersele and Charles Heard succeeded in their second attempt on the hitherto unclimbed W ridge of Bhagirathi I. With its Chamonix granite topped off by a fine snow climb, they compared it to the Peuterey Ridge Intégrale on Mont Blanc. Tragically on the descent, a metal-nut belay gave way in the course of an abseil by Charles Heard, who fell 800m to his death.

August 1983
Martin Moran, John Mothersele and Charles Heard from Britain
